Girard (1907-1993) created a modernist style that's unique to the USA. He was heavily influenced by Bauhaus. Part Italian, and had a particular talent for colour and pattern making, to be seen in his textiles and graphics.
Vitra, who own the Girard archive, based the present dolls on the originals created by Girard.
